500gflourI usually use 300g spelt and 200 whole wheat flour
400mlluke warm waterI always prepare 500 ml
42gyeastin a cube
10gsalt
100gseedsI usually use 50g pumpkin seeds and 50g sunflower seeds
Instructions
Pre-heat the oven to 180 degrees. In the meantime slightly butter the cake form and place some seeds at the bottom.
In a large bowl, disolve the yeast with the luke warm water and ensure that no lumps remain. I strongly suggest you start with 400 ml (from the 500 ml prepared) and then see how the flour(s) you are using is reacting and whether you will need to use the full 500 ml.
Add the flour(s), salt and seeds and mix by hand until you get a homogeneous dough. Continue to knead within the bowl for about 5 mins. You will realise that this dough is very moist, but don't worry, the flour will absorb the moisture completely.
Place the (most probably) sticky dough into your prepared cake form and bake for about 45 mins. You might want to take the bread out of the form and turn it around for an additional 5 mins at the very end. As with every bread, I suggest you knock on the bread to ensure that it is thoroughly baked.
